Syllabus
The BITSAT test will be conducted on the basis of NCERT syllabus for 11th and 12th class.
Needless to say, the expected difficulty of the test will be greater than that of the NCERT Boards, therefore they require careful time management and exam strategy.
A sample test demonstrating the features of BITSAT will be made available to the registered candidates at the BITS website on which he/she can practice as many times as desired.

BITSAT Syllabus for Physics:
- Kinematics
- Newton’s Laws of Motion
- Oscillations
- Units & Measurement
- Mechanics of Solids and Fluids
- Impulse and Momentum
- Work and Energy
- Rotational Motion
- Gravitation
- Heat and Thermodynamics
- Electrostatics
- Electronic Devices
- Current Electricity
- Waves
- Magnetic Effect of Current
- Optics
- Electromagnetic Induction
- Modern Physics
BITSAT Syllabus for Chemistry:
- Electrochemistry
- Atomic Structure
- Chemical Bonding & Molecular Structure
- Chemical Kinetics
- Thermodynamics
- States of Matter
- Hydrogen and s-block elements
- Physical and Chemical Equilibria
- p- d- and f-block elements
- Stereochemistry
- Principles of Organic Chemistry and Hydrocarbons
- Theoretical Principles of Experimental Chemistry
- Organic Compounds with Functional Groups Containing Oxygen and Nitrogen
- Biological , Industrial and Environmental chemistry
BITSAT Syllabus for Mathematics:
- Trigonometry
- Algebra
- Two-dimensional Coordinate Geometry
- Differential calculus
- Three-dimensional Coordinate Geometry
- Linear Programming
- Ordinary Differential Equations
- Vectors
- Integral calculus
- Probability
- Statistics
- Mathematical Modelling
BITSAT Syllabus for English Proficiency & Logical Reasoning:
- Vocabulary
- Grammar
- Composition
- Reading Comprehension
- Nonverbal Reasoning
- Verbal Reasoning
